New Toolkit to Support Community Hustings
Following the manifesto launch in November, we’ve been focusing on developing our new How to Organise a Hustings Toolkit, created to help community groups plan and run inclusive and well‑organised hustings events. It includes practical guidance, templates, and tips covering planning, promotion, accessibility, and event delivery.

A Good thing
A Good Thing is an award-winning non-profit online platform that matches wonderful UK charities with organisations that have things to donate: helping charities while providing organisations with an ethical means of disposing of unwanted goods.
Welsh Charities week is taking place from 9 – 13 February 2026
Welsh Charities Week, sponsored by Utility Aid, is a chance to recognise and celebrate all the work that people and organisations across the voluntary sector in Wales do to shine a bit of light in the dark. It’s an opportunity to come together and show appreciation, to remind people that what they do makes a difference.
